
Over six months, contributed to the yugabyte/yugabyte-db repository by enabling advanced PostgreSQL extension development and integrating the Apache AGE graph extension, expanding YugabyteDB’s capabilities to support graph workloads with openCypher. Leveraged C, C++, and Rust to adapt build systems, optimize Makefiles, and ensure cross-platform compatibility, particularly for macOS and CI/CD environments. Improved developer workflows by introducing build flags, streamlining extension onboarding, and maintaining accurate upstream repository tracking. Addressed data management and system integration challenges by aligning repository metadata and enhancing transactional safety for graph operations, resulting in a more flexible, reliable, and extensible distributed database platform for developers.
April 2026: Delivered targeted data hygiene improvement for YugabyteDB by aligning the upstream repositories list with the Apache cherry-pick (issue #2117). This fix ensures the upstream_repositories.csv is current and accurate, reducing build and CI drift for downstream integrations. The change was implemented in yugabyte/yugabyte-db with a single commit (6be3d9ef8e71017917affda6613279186eeeff23).
April 2026: Delivered targeted data hygiene improvement for YugabyteDB by aligning the upstream repositories list with the Apache cherry-pick (issue #2117). This fix ensures the upstream_repositories.csv is current and accurate, reducing build and CI drift for downstream integrations. The change was implemented in yugabyte/yugabyte-db with a single commit (6be3d9ef8e71017917affda6613279186eeeff23).
In February 2026, delivered end-to-end integration of the Apache AGE graph extension into YugabyteDB, enabling graph workloads with openCypher support on a distributed storage backend. Implemented upstream AGE integration, compatibility adaptations, and YB-specific adaptations for data types, indexing, MVCC, and DDL/transaction handling. Hardened the DDL path and catalog interactions for graph objects, and updated the DML executors to operate correctly on DocDB/LSM-based storage. Validated integration with the Apache AGE test suite and prepared for upstream review. Impact highlights the business value of extending YugabyteDB with native graph capabilities, unlocking graph analytics and graph-based workflows for existing customers, while preserving strong consistency, scalability, and demand-driven performance characteristics.
In February 2026, delivered end-to-end integration of the Apache AGE graph extension into YugabyteDB, enabling graph workloads with openCypher support on a distributed storage backend. Implemented upstream AGE integration, compatibility adaptations, and YB-specific adaptations for data types, indexing, MVCC, and DDL/transaction handling. Hardened the DDL path and catalog interactions for graph objects, and updated the DML executors to operate correctly on DocDB/LSM-based storage. Validated integration with the Apache AGE test suite and prepared for upstream review. Impact highlights the business value of extending YugabyteDB with native graph capabilities, unlocking graph analytics and graph-based workflows for existing customers, while preserving strong consistency, scalability, and demand-driven performance characteristics.
Month: 2025-10. Concise monthly summary focusing on build tooling improvements and developer productivity for yugabyte/yugabyte-db.
Month: 2025-10. Concise monthly summary focusing on build tooling improvements and developer productivity for yugabyte/yugabyte-db.
September 2025 (yugabyte/yugabyte-db): Delivered cross-platform macOS build stability and consistent YSQL build configuration. Key changes suppress macOS-specific compiler warnings in the Makefile (CFLAGS) to prevent build failures and enhance cross-platform reliability, and set CFLAGS for all pg_parquet YSQL builds to remove build variance. Commit: 863ac81f15f7d772e1d65ec6124a1ba0fa81de8a. Impact: smoother CI, fewer platform-specific issues, faster developer iteration. Technologies/skills: Makefile tuning, CFLAGS handling, macOS toolchain, YSQL, pg_parquet, cross-platform build engineering.
September 2025 (yugabyte/yugabyte-db): Delivered cross-platform macOS build stability and consistent YSQL build configuration. Key changes suppress macOS-specific compiler warnings in the Makefile (CFLAGS) to prevent build failures and enhance cross-platform reliability, and set CFLAGS for all pg_parquet YSQL builds to remove build variance. Commit: 863ac81f15f7d772e1d65ec6124a1ba0fa81de8a. Impact: smoother CI, fewer platform-specific issues, faster developer iteration. Technologies/skills: Makefile tuning, CFLAGS handling, macOS toolchain, YSQL, pg_parquet, cross-platform build engineering.
August 2025: Delivered targeted pg_parquet Makefile optimizations and CI fixes for yugabyte/yugabyte-db, achieving faster builds, reduced disk usage, and more reliable CI on GitHub Actions and macOS. The work streamlined developer workflows and contributed to overall build stability.
August 2025: Delivered targeted pg_parquet Makefile optimizations and CI fixes for yugabyte/yugabyte-db, achieving faster builds, reduced disk usage, and more reliable CI on GitHub Actions and macOS. The work streamlined developer workflows and contributed to overall build stability.
June 2025 monthly summary for yugabyte/yugabyte-db: Focused on enabling PostgreSQL extension development via PGRX and improving extension discovery/integration. Key achievements include integrating PGRX framework with YSQL build, tracking the pg_parquet extension in upstream repositories, and ensuring build system compatibility for Rust-based extensions. These efforts lay groundwork for broader ecosystem of PostgreSQL extensions in YugabyteDB, accelerating developer workflows and customer adoption.
June 2025 monthly summary for yugabyte/yugabyte-db: Focused on enabling PostgreSQL extension development via PGRX and improving extension discovery/integration. Key achievements include integrating PGRX framework with YSQL build, tracking the pg_parquet extension in upstream repositories, and ensuring build system compatibility for Rust-based extensions. These efforts lay groundwork for broader ecosystem of PostgreSQL extensions in YugabyteDB, accelerating developer workflows and customer adoption.

Overview of all repositories you've contributed to across your timeline